正交频分复用(OFDM)和多输入多输出(MIMO)技术是解决未来宽带无线通信系统中多径衰落信道和带宽效率两大技术难点的关键技术。分析了MIMO系统模型和空时分组码(SBTC)的编解码原理,建立了基于SBTC的MIMO-OFDM的系统模型,并对其性能进行了仿真分析。仿真结果表明,空时编码与MIMO-OFDM的结合,能够充分利用空域、频域、时域分集,有效地改善系统性能。
OFDM (Orthogonal Frequency Division Multiplexing) and MIMO (Multiple-Input- Multiple-Output) are two key techniques that can be used to solve the bandwidth efficiency and muhipath fading channel problems in future broadband wireless communication system. MIMO system scheme and space-time coding is analyzed. With an established MIMO-OFDM system model based on space time coding, its performance is simulated and analyzed. Simulations shows that combining space-time coding with MIMO-OFDM system, which make full use of space diversity, frequency diversity and time diversity can be effectively applied to improve system performance.
